These projects are part of the Guyana Utility-Scale Photovoltaic Programme (GUYSOL), a government-led initiative designed to diversify the nation''s energy mix by incorporating large-scale solar farms. This is a key element in Guyana''s strategy to achieve sustainable and resilient energy systems.

The 1.5 MW PV Plant at Bartica was designed to accommodate increased levels of solar PV penetration as Bartica''s load grows. At maximum capacity, the system will generate and supply a total of 1,988 MWh to the grid, resulting in an estimated annual reduction of 4,500 drums of diesel consumption and a 1.5 million kilogram reduction in carbon dioxide emissions.

To propel efforts and push towards sustainable, economically-friendly energy solutions, the Guyana Utility-Scale Solar Photovoltaic programme (GUYSOL) is being fully utilised, and is on target to complete the construction of solar farms at Linden, on the Essequibo Coast, and Berbice, which, in total, will have a generation capacity of 33MW.
These solar projects represent the largest renewable energy investment in Guyana''s history, providing a foundation for future growth in renewable power generation and supporting the country''s transition away from fossil fuels. As of 2018, the total installed capacity for Solar PV in Guyana is 4.63 MW, with an estimated annual generation of 7.16 GWh. Solar energy is used for several purposes in Guyana, including drying agricultural produce, irrigation, ICT, and to improve electricity access in rural areas.
Guyana Power and Light Inc. (GPL) is preparing plans for three utility-scale solar PV farms totaling 30 MW for the national grid in the long term, as well as a 0.75 MW Solar PV Farm at Wakenaam and a 4 MW Solar PV Farm at Onverwagt in the near future.
Most locations across Guyana have excellent solar insolation levels and are ideal for solar PV generation. As of 2018, the total installed capacity for Solar PV in Guyana is 4.63 MW, with an estimated annual generation of 7.16 GWh.
Currently, imported petroleum-based fuels are the main source of energy in Guyana.
